Abstract
A method and apparatus for measuring network performance. A packet from a stream of multimedia data packets is received from across a network during a measurement interval. The time interval from the start of the measurement interval to receiving the packet is measured. The response of a buffer to the received packet is determined. The level of the buffer just before the packet arrives is calculated, based on the time interval. The level of the buffer just after the packet arrives is calculated, based on the previous level. A performance measure for the network is determined based on at least one of the two levels.
